Priest held for molestation attempt in North Garo Hills

TURA: A missionary priest has been arrested in North Garo Hills after passengers of a night bus he was travelling in handed him over to Bajengdoba police for allegedly attempting to molest a co-passenger on Friday night.
The accused priest, identified as Father Biju Joseph, belonging to the Guwahati Provincial of the Missionaries of St Francis De Sales (MSFS) congregation, was serving as the parish priest of Sumonpara where the MSFS has only recently started work in the education sector.
The congregation also runs the St. Francis De Sales School in remote Nangalbibra area of South Garo Hills. According to the police complaint, the accused priest was travelling from Shillong to Tura on the Millennium Wave night bus on Friday night when he allegedly tried to hold the hand of a woman seated next to him several times.
The incident is said to have occurred after the night bus left Paikan en route to Tura shortly after midnight.
The 27-year-old woman passenger, working in the Health Department, raised an alarm and other passengers soon came to her rescue. They accosted the accused priest and he was slapped by some angry passengers.
When the bus reached Bajengdoba, the passengers handed him over to the police along with his luggage in which police found four bottles of expensive brandy.
The accused priest has been booked under Section 354 9(A) of the Indian Penal Code for outraging the modesty of a woman and forwarded to the court.
